Doctor with $300K salary earns more as TikTok influencer than at her day job

A doctor has become an influencer and now makes more money on social media than her $300K physician salary — sharing educational videos online. 

Dr. Fran Haydanek, 37, completed her studies at Lake Erie College of Osteopathic Medicine in 2017 and began her career as an obstetrician-gynecologist (OB/GYN), with an annual income of $300K.

In 2021, she ventured into posting TikTok videos to address misinformation regarding reproductive health topics such as menopause, pregnancy, and birth control.

For a while, she didn’t earn anything from her social media activities, but by 2023, she began making money through the TikTok creator fund, eventually surpassing her OB/GYN salary.

So far in 2025, Dr. Fran has already earned her $300k salary from social media, and she says the extra income has allowed her to start paying off her student loan and save for retirement.

The physician, from Rochester, New York, said: “I have three young children, and a husband who also works as a physician – we have been playing catch-up in our life.

“The extra income has allowed us to have an emergency fund and start saving for our retirement.

“It has also allowed me to take two extra days off a month to spend more time with my kids.

“We are a bit more financially fine, we are working on paying off our student loans.”

In 2021, Dr. Fran was scrolling through social media when she came across “a lot of misinformation around childbirth and labor” – including how brith control works, and misunderstanding around medical conditions in pregnancy

She started posting educational videos on TikTok to combat some of the misinformation she saw – including videos about medical recommendations.

Dr. Fran said: “I was spending a lot of time scrolling, I kept seeing topics about labor, delivery, and pregnancy come up.

“I saw that there was a lot of incorrect information out there, and I felt like someone should be addressing the misinformation.

“I started by correcting or giving more insight to those misinformation posts.”

In 2023, Dr. Fran started earning a “little bit of money” on social media, which she tripled in 2024.

So far this year, Dr. Fran has already surpassed her $300K salary with her social media posts – in a few years.

Dr. Fran said: “At this point in 2024, I have already made what I will make in my entire year of being a physician.

“As a physician, I am already privileged with my finances.

“The extra income has made me feel more secure, because even if I couldn’t do my job, I have a way to earn money.

“I’m always in the mindset that social media is temporary – for me, it is a nice way to bolster my income.

“This is a nice way to get ahead financially, when I have been playing catch up with money my whole life.”

Despite her financial success with social media, Dr. Fran insists that she will never quit her day job. 

Dr. Fran said her patients will seek her out from seeing her social media posts

She also wants to encourage other doctors to be resourceful with their skills and earn an extra income.

Dr. Fran said: “I feel very strongly about the work that I do, and I feel a real responsibility to be there for my patients.

“I have worked very hard to get here, and I enjoy the work I do.

“My passion is social media, but I love my patients.

“The reason I started TikTok is because I want other doctors to know that there is another avenue out there.

“I want to encourage other doctors that they too can do this, and be resourceful.”
